A driveway crossover is replaced by using a cut and replace process which involves cutting and removing the damaged asphalt in a neat shape, trimming or preparing the existing underlying road base to the required depth, applying an adhesive bitumen spray to the patch, and then filling the area with new asphalt flush with the existing.

Quick fact / Did you know?

To improve the look and durability of your asphalt repair and to prevent water from making its way into the road base beneath the asphalt you should consider applying a bitumen joint tape. A bitumen joint tape is effective at protecting the joint between the new and the existing asphalt and preventing water from undermining the repair. The bitumen tape is applied cold and heated with a gas hot torch to melt the tape to ensure it adheres to the asphalt with a lasting result. A typical bitumen joint tape will be 50mm wide and is supplied in a 15m or 20m roll.
